My research shows that usage of "contiguous to" has greatly exceeded "contiguous with" for several centuries until relatively recently. Usage of "contiguous to" still exceeds "contiguous with," but by a very narrow margin. Try plugging these into a Google n-gram and you'll see the usage history since 1800.

In a contiguous memory allocation there is no overhead during execution of a program. In a non contiguous memory allocation address translation is performed during execution.

Contiguous means to share an edge or boundary, touching, adjacent, neighbouring and so on. Thus contiguous storage allocation is any allocation that consumes two or more contiguous storage elements. In the case of contiguous memory allocation, this means two or more contiguous memory addresses are allocated. A one-dimensional array is an example of a contiguous memory allocation, where one array element (a data type) is immediately followed by the next.

The contiguous United States are often referred to as the "lower 48". There are 48 contiguous states. Alaska and Hawaii are separated from the "lower 48" by Canada and the Pacific Ocean, respectively.

There is no such thing as a non-contiguous range. A range is a group of cells that are together in a rectangular block. Non-contiguous refers to cells that are not touching. So you can have more than one range which do not touch, so what you have are non-contiguous ranges. It is possible to select non-contiguous ranges by first selecting one range and then while holding the Ctrl key, select other ranges.

Contiguous means adjacent; touching; right next to; consecutive; sequential; or close together, but not touching. Contiguous events are adjacent in time. Contiguous memory locations are right next to each other in address space, as in (3), (4), (5).

In computer terminology, contiguous is sometimes distinguished from consecutive or continuous, because 'continuous' or 'consecutive' could apply in absolute addressing, but possibly may not apply in virtual space or relative [indirect] addressing.
